New Donkervoort D8 GTO gets Audi 2.5 litre turbo with up to 400hp

Mon, 19 Dec 2011

New Donkervoort D8 GTO Dutch firm Donkervoort has revealed their D8 GTO with an Audi 2.5 litre 5-pot engine with up to 400hp and a 0-60mph of 3 seconds. Dutch maker of bonkers cars, Jooop Donkervoort, has unleashed his new, lightweight and totally impractical car – the Donkervoort D8 GTO – after what seems an age of development. And thanks to a close working relationship with Audi, the D8 GTO pretty much lives up to its cheeky GTO moniker.

2009 BMW Z4 announced

Sun, 14 Dec 2008

BMW has officially released details of the next BMW Z4, due to be shown at Detroit and in UK showrooms in the spring. The new Z4 looks like a big improvement on the outgoing model. The old Z4 had Marmite looks – you loved it or hated it – but the new BMW Z4 has much more voluptuous lines.

Subaru WRX concept stars at the 2013 Frankfurt Motor Show

Tue, 10 Sep 2013

The Subaru WRX concept starring here at the 2013 Frankfurt Motor Show is striking to say the least – it’s like someone has driven the Japanese firm’s BRZ sports car into the back of an old Impreza WRX STi performance saloon. In fact, that’s exactly what the WRX concept could become – the next Subaru Impreza WRX STi. Subaru killed off the rally-bred saloon in the UK this year, but we’re sure the Brits would welcome it back with open arms if it looked like this.
